What Are Forex Options?
First and foremost, it is important that you do not confuse an option with an actual currency position. A forex option is a contract that gives the rights to either buy or sell a long or short position at a fixed price and within a specified time. When you trade options, you are basically just trading your privileges for positions in forex crosses but not the currency pairs themselves.
These forex options are very important in the market because they provide advanced investors with extra opportunities that could pave way to better returns in doing business within the currency market. Investors usually make use of these rights to evade from price declines, to give insurance for the price of a future purchase, or even to help them speculate future trend in currency markets..
There are two kinds of options – call options and put options. Call options give purchasers the privilege to buy underlying currency pairs, while put options allow the purchaser to sell the underlying stocks.
How Do You Exercise Options?
If you already own an option, you can exercise buying or selling the underlying currency position on its expiration date. This would allow you to trade the forex pair at a set price regardless of what the current market price is for those particular currencies involved.
Thus, you can have the privilege of buying or selling currencies against others in cases where you fear that prices might get too high or too low for you. This way, you have certain degree of insurance on the investments that you make. A lot of investors simply make trades without any intent of possessing the underlying securities.
How Do You Trade Options?
Take note that in trading options the pricing may be extremely complicated. But it will depend on two major factors – the pricing of the underlying currencies and the amount of time remaining within the contract.
The spot price level for actual currency pairs that accompany the options directly affects the price of the option. If the demand for the one currency is high, the price for the options will also go up and vice versa.
The amount of time left within the contract for an option also influences the price. As time expires, the price for the option may go down as it may become less desirable.
